What is a Mulching Mower?
A mulching mower cuts grass into very small pieces. These tiny clippings fall back onto your lawn. They act like fertilizer. This feeds your grass and keeps it healthy. You don’t have to bag or rake them.
Key Features to Look For
- Cutting Deck Size: This is how wide the mower cuts. A bigger deck mows your lawn faster. For small yards, a 20-inch deck is fine. For larger yards, consider 21 inches or more.
- Engine Power: More power means the mower can handle thick or wet grass. Look for engines with at least 5 horsepower for good performance.
- Wheel Size: Larger rear wheels make the mower easier to push, especially on uneven ground.
- Adjustable Cutting Height: You need to be able to set the mower to cut grass at different heights. This is good for different seasons or grass types.
- Ergonomic Handle: A comfortable handle makes mowing less tiring. Some handles are padded.
- Easy Start System: This makes starting the engine much simpler. No more pulling a cord many times.
Important Materials
- Steel Deck: Most mulching mower decks are made of steel. Look for thick, rust-resistant steel. This means your mower will last longer.
- Blade Material: The cutting blade is important. High-quality steel blades stay sharp longer. They also mulch grass better.
- Wheels: Plastic wheels are common. Some mowers have ball bearings in the wheels. This makes them roll smoother.
Factors That Improve or Reduce Quality
- Engine Brand: Well-known engine brands often mean better reliability and durability.
- Deck Construction: A thicker, stronger deck will resist damage better.
- Blade Design: Blades designed for mulching have special curves. These help chop the grass finely.
- Ease of Maintenance: How easy is it to clean the deck or change the oil? This affects how well you can care for your mower.
- Durability: A well-built mower will last for many years. Poorly made ones can break down quickly.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
Q: What is the main benefit of a mulching mower?
A: The main benefit is that it returns grass clippings to your lawn. These clippings act as a natural fertilizer. This makes your lawn healthier.
Q: Do mulching mowers work in wet grass?
A: They work best in dry or slightly damp grass. Very wet grass can clump. This can make mulching less effective. You might need a mower with more power for wet conditions.
Q: Can I use a mulching mower for bagging?
A: Some mulching mowers can also bag clippings. You can switch between mulching and bagging. Check the mower’s features to see if it has this option.
Q: How often should I change the mulching blade?
A: It depends on how often you mow and the type of grass. Most experts suggest sharpening or replacing the blade at least once a year. You will notice if the grass is not being cut cleanly.
Q: Are mulching mowers more expensive?
A: They can be slightly more expensive. The cost is often worth it for the time and fertilizer savings. Many good options are available at different price points.
Q: What size yard is a mulching mower best for?
A: Most walk-behind mulching mowers are ideal for small to medium-sized yards. Larger yards might benefit from a riding mower with mulching capabilities.
Q: How do I maintain my mulching mower?
A: Keep the mower deck clean. Sharpen or replace the blade regularly. Check the oil and air filter. Follow the manufacturer’s instructions for best results.
Q: Will mulching leave my lawn looking messy?
A: No, if the mower is working correctly. The blades chop the grass into very fine pieces. These disappear into the turf.
Q: Do I need special blades for mulching?
A: Yes. Mulching mowers use special mulching blades. These blades have a curved design. This helps them cut the grass multiple times.
Q: Can mulching help with weeds?
A: Mulching can help suppress some small weeds. The clippings can block sunlight. This makes it harder for weed seeds to grow. It is not a complete weed solution.
